Can anyone explain Le Fee.

Is it the dire fixtures after the first two weeks, or the lack of attacking returns outside of set pieces that make him so attractive?

2

u/tommangan7 1 5d ago

Averaged 4.1 pts/90 last season which in price per million is pretty good for the price bracket especially. To compare a comparable priced pick he has moderately worse xG than ndiaye and better xA than ndiaye. He also took 4 penalties last year. Not a lot but he averaged more defcon returns than ndiaye/gross too. Grew into the team as the season went on. Lots of people will also be looking to wildcard gw 3 or 4.

Not got him in my team but I can see why people would.

the template thing is actually measurable this year and it's worse than it feels.

five players are owned by over a third of the game: haaland 69%, joao pedro 63%, bruno 51%, szoboszlai 42%, raya 37%.

those five cost 48.0m between them. so roughly half the budget is committed before you've made a single decision of your own, and then everyone spends three weeks arguing about which 5.5 arsenal defender to buy with what's left.

no wonder people are opening this and finding 8/11.
